Q.

The area of cross-section of a large tank is 0.5 m2,  it has a narrow opening near the bottom having area of cross-section 1cm2 . A load of 25 kg is applied on the water at the top in the tank. Neglecting the speed of water in the tank, the velocity of water, coming out of the opening at the time when water level in the tank is  40 cm above the bottom, will be  cms1[Takeg=10 ms2]

Using Bernoulli's principle :

PA+12ρVA2=PB+12ρVB2

P0+2500.5+(0.4×1000×10)+12ρ(0)2=P0+12ρVB2

4500=12(1000)VB2

VB=3m/s=300cm/s
